Annalise Baso is an acclaimed American actor. Snowpiercer is one of her more well-known film. She has starred in the films Bedtime Stories Love Takes Wing Standing up Oculus as well as Ouija: Origin of Evil. Between 2014 and 2015 she was on The Red Road. Campbell Hall School is located in Studio City, in Los Angeles. Annalise (n e December 2, 1997) Basso is an American model, actress and TV personality. Alexandria Basso (her older sister) as well as Gabriel Basso (her elder brother) are actors as well. Annalise was born into the Basso acting family. Marcie's youngest daughter, Annalise Basso has two brothers and a sister named Gabriel and Alexandria. The majority of her first roles included commercials on TV or smaller one-time roles in various shows. Eden Hamby was her first major part. In 2009, she performed an important character in the tv movie Love Takes Wing from the Love Comes Softly series. In the age of 10 she was a part of the show on television, Are You smarter than a fifth Grader? The film featured her as she played an individual from her school. Recently the most notable roles she has played include New Girl episodes and Nikita. Her first leading role in a feature film was in D.J. Caruso's Standing Up is a film about growing up based on Brock Cole's book The Goats, which premiered at the 2012 Cannes Film Festival. The film follows two kids who are played by Basso and Chandler Canterbury who are stripped naked and then left on a small island as part of a prank at summer camp.
